Notice to Mariners No.066(T) – 25

Published on 2 February 2025

 


Ocean Grove Boat Ramp: 

Barge Craning Operations

Temporary Boat Ramp Closure

 

Date: Effective from 3 February 2025

 

Details:
Mariners and boat ramp users are advised of barge craning works being
undertaken at the Ocean Grove Boat Ramp at approximate location (WGS84)
38°15.768’S 144°30.478’E.

Proposed works will include, cranes on boat ramp, on-water plant and vessels.

Boat ramp will be closed between 8am-10am, Monday 3 February 2025 during craning operations.

Barge will be jacked up on the northern side of the western floating pontoon at
Ocean Grove Boat Ramp and left in place for a period of approximately three
weeks to allow for loading of navigational aids and equipment.

Barge details are as follows: GEMINAE UVI1461535, 6.4m length x 3.2m beam.

Mariners and boat ramp users are advised not to use the boat ramp during the specified boat ramp closure period.
